The history of Meenvallam Waterfall is intertwined with the local tribal communities who have long revered the area for its natural resources and spiritual significance. While there are no grand historical events directly linked to the falls, it has served as a vital source of water and sustenance for the indigenous people. In recent years, with increased tourism, efforts have been made to preserve the natural integrity of the area and promote sustainable tourism practices. The local community plays a crucial role in managing the falls and ensuring its protection for future generations. The name 'Meenvallam' translates to 'fish valley,' indicating the abundance of aquatic life that once thrived in the river, further highlighting its ecological importance.
